Output 9177bb65d132582e90189e55d9bdf2dce7b498ad32088d17b4f7511c7522a0fa:0

value
633230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d624285675f77329815a29605ffa25ea184afba4 OP_EQUAL
address
3MDHqsGFrobV6iV9ku8si7xfwdGMkxugEY
transaction
9177bb65d132582e90189e55d9bdf2dce7b498ad32088d17b4f7511c7522a0fa
spent
true